#7b0292 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b0292 is composed of 48.2% red, 0.8%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.8% cyan, 98.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 290.4 degrees, a saturation of 97.3% and a lightness of 29%. #7b0292 color hex could be obtained by blending #f604ff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#7b0292
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09000b is the darkest color, while #fdf6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7b0292
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d464e is the less saturated color, while #7b0292 is the most saturated one.
